Fine-Tuning Performance in Today's Databases
In the dynamic realm of modern database management, performance optimization stands as a paramount priority. As dataset sizes continue to swell, ensuring optimal processing power is critical for maintaining reliability.
Databases today are increasingly sophisticated, incorporating a multitude of technologies designed to boost performance. Developers can leverage these cutting-edge capabilities through a variety of strategies, including:
*
Query optimization: Carefully crafting and executing queries to minimize latency.
*
Data Structures: Implementing appropriate indexes to accelerate data retrieval.
*
Memory Utilization: Storing frequently accessed data in memory for quicker click here access.
These are just a few examples of the many approaches available for optimizing query speeds. By adopting these strategies, organizations can ensure their databases remain efficient even as data requirements continue to grow.
